General Info

In Block

3d5fbe7c0f4bccd254a202183d6e46e6e3ba39d69e5f4279fc0e4d27e4ea3877

In block height

5355689

Total Input

44155.63319002 DGB

Total Output

44155.63148402 DGB

Transaction Details